Who is Paul MacLean?

Paul A. MacLean is a Canadian professional ice hockey coach and former player. MacLean played eleven seasons in the National Hockey League with the St. Louis Blues, Detroit Red Wings, and the original Winnipeg Jets. He currently serves as the head coach of the NHL's Ottawa Senators, winning the 2013 Jack Adams Award as the NHL's coach of the year.
